...
In rare instances, on HPE ProLiant Gen10 and Gen10 Plus Servers configured with an HPE 12G SAS Expander Card running firmware version 5.10 (or earlier), the SAS expander card may stop responding due to a task set full condition, and the Gen10 or Gen10 Plus server may stop responding. This issue occurs when the Smart Array controller accesses the drives in HBA mode (No fault tolerant RAID), and the LUN Reset is processed along with other outstanding SCSI commands by the expander firmware. The firmware runs out of tasks, causing a task set full condition. When this occurs, the host may log errors to the operating system logs. NOTE : This issue was observed on an HPE ProLiant DL380 Gen10 Microsoft Azure Stack Hub node configured with an HPE 12G SAS Expander Card running Windows Server 2019 Datacenter using disk drive model number MB010000JWRTE, but this issue may also occur on other Gen10 or Gen10 Plus servers with other configurations or operating systems. See the following examples of Windows System Event logs and Serial Output logs: Windows System Event Logs: Event ID: 129 Source: SmartPqi Level: Warning Reset to device, \Device\RaidPort2, was issued. Event ID: 153 Source: Disk Level: Warning The IO operation at logical block address 0x22c00 for Disk 12 (PDO name: \Device\0000008b) was retried. Event ID: 5008 Source: SmartPqi Level: Warning The controller in slot 0 (bus 92, device 0, f unction 0), the OS requested a Reset of LUN (2, 2, 11 SOB (Serial Output Buffer log) also called Slot.x report:Fatal Error 02:04:28 TASK SET FULL : Fatal [ctrl] PREQ=81b7b198 D377 Op=1c PLErr=02 IopErr=04 S=28 CHECK CONDITION, Completion With Error, TASK SET FULL
Any HPE ProLiant Gen10 or Gen10 Plus systems that support the HPE 12 SAS Expander Card are affected by this issue: HPE ProLiant DL180 Gen10 Server HPE ProLiant DL325 Gen10 Plus Server HPE ProLiant DL345 Gen10 Plus server HPE ProLiant DL380 Gen10 Server HPE ProLiant DL385 Gen10 Plus Server HPE ProLiant DL385 Gen10 Plus v2 server HPE ProLiant DL560 Gen10 Server HPE ProLiant DL580 Gen10 Server HPE ProLiant ML110 Gen10 Server HPE ProLiant ML350 Gen10 Server
To correct this issue, upgrade the HPE 12G SAS Expander Card firmware to version 5.12 or later. Refer to the following ROM Flash Components for download instructions, release notes, and other information: Online ROM Flash Component for Windows (x64) - HPE 12Gb/s SAS Expander Firmware for HPE Smart Array Controllers and HPE HBA Controllers Online ROM Flash Component for Linux (x64) - HPE 12Gb/s SAS Expander Firmware for HPE Smart Array Controllers and HPE HBA Controllers Online ROM Flash Component for VMware ESXi - HPE 12Gb/s SAS Expander Firmware for HPE Smart Array Controllers and HPE HBA Controllers 5.12 RECEIVE PROACTIVE UPDATES : Receive support alerts (such as Customer Advisories), as well as updates on drivers, software, firmware, and customer replaceable components, proactively in your e-mail through HPE Support Alerts. Sign up for Support Alerts at the following URL: Proactive Updates Subscription Form.
Click on a version to see all relevant bugs
Hewlett Packard Enterprise Integration
Learn more about where this data comes from
Bug Scrub Advisor
Streamline upgrades with automated vendor bug scrubs
BugZero Enterprise
Wish you caught this bug sooner? Get proactive today.